Golf Outing
The annual golf outing began from an idea in 1992 to become a key fund raiser for the parish. Before this, the major fund raiser for the church was the gyro trailer at the Big E. As the fair grew, so did the requirements necessary to support the trailer. The need to find an alternative project, one that provided stewardship across the parish, became apparent and the golf outing was created.
In May of 1993 the First Annual Greek Orthodox Church of St. Luke Golf Outing was held. The links were filled with golfers. Those who did not golf joined in the dinner and raffle which followed. Due to the uncertainty of the spring weather and the attendance difficulties of Monday events, the date was moved to June and Saturdays.
